PRP Facials
The blood contains plasma, red and white blood cells, and platelets. You need platelets to clot your blood and produce growth factors that promote healing. A portion of your blood platelets is used in PRP facial rejuvenation to help heal and rejuvenate your skin.

When you come to the office for your PRP Facial, a small blood sample will be drawn, and then a centrifuge will separate the platelet-rich plasma (PRP) from the blood. Platelets are concentrated many times higher than they would typically be. Then they’ll use the SkinPen to microneedle platelet-rich plasma on the desired areas of improvement.

It usually takes 4-9 months for results to become apparent.
It’s expected that the results of PRP Treatments will be long-lasting, though the results may vary from person to person.
The duration of sessions varies for each patient. Our recommendation is for 3-4 treatments separated by 4-6 weeks, followed by 1-2 maintenance treatments per year.
Bruising and swelling may occur after injections. You should try to plan two weeks ahead of time for any events or vacations.
After PRP microneedling, your skin may be red for 1-2 days and will not peel.
